Ultrasonically Assisted Extraction (UAE) and Microwave Assisted Extraction (MAE) of Functional Compounds from Plant Materials
Trends in Analytical Chemistry ( IF 13.1 ) Pub Date : 2017-09-14 , DOI: 10.1016/j.trac.2017.09.002
M. Vinatoru , T.J. Mason , I. Calinescu

In order to identify the chemical constituents of vegetal material it is important that an efficient extraction procedure is followed which provides both an efficient extraction and also limits the decomposition of extracted compounds during the process. Traditional methods such as distillation, solvent extraction and cold compression continue to be used but significant improvements can be achieved with the application of either ultrasound or microwave technologies. In this review we will discuss the development of these methods and review the advantages which can be achieved.
